启用Confluence以在Windows Server 2012中的端口80上运行

时间:2014-10-02 19:06:14

标签: windows iis azure windows-server-2012 confluence

我很难在端口80上的Windows Server 2012上运行Confluence。(在Azure中托管的机器这就是我需要在端口80上运行它的原因(我无法访问其他端口,我正试图在使用这个))。

我相信必须在端口80上运行一些东西,尽管我做了一个netstat -y并没有看到任何东西。

我认为它的IIS有任何想法我应该如何杀死它或者还有什么可能导致汇合而不能在端口80上运行?

*汇合工作找到端口8090,但我需要在端口80上运行它。

请注意,我无法在Windows服务器的本地实例上运行80端口,不要介意从其他位置访问它,因此我不认为这与azure有任何关系

运行一个     netstat -abn 没有显示在端口80上运行的任何东西。我仍然不确定为什么我不能在本地端口80上工作。

2 个答案:

答案 0 :(得分:1)

Azure中的虚拟机无法直接公开访问。您需要在cloudservice中配置端点(充当负载均衡器)。

因此,例如,您可以在cloudservice上配置公共端点端口80以指向您的VM端口8090.有关详细信息,请参阅http://azure.microsoft.com/en-us/documentation/articles/virtual-machines-set-up-endpoints/

endpoint config example

答案 1 :(得分:0)

如果端点在Azure上打开到VM,那么我的建议是检查主机上的防火墙设置。通常,大多数端口都会关闭,除非通过安装IIS(Windows Web服务器)等功能明确打开它们。